Shot taken at St Peter’s Cathedral, Geneva. This dragon rests on a misericord in the choir of the cathedral and holds the emblem of Geneva. The choir stalls date from the 15th century. These stalls survived the Reformation because they weren't here at the time - they are from the destroyed Chapelle des Florentins.
